If you get paged about runaway formula evaluations, don't panic — user-supplied formulas run inside the Hexcage sandbox, so the blast radius is limited to one worker pod. First, check whether the offending formula tripped the CPU or memory ceiling; the sandbox kills it either way, but repeated retries can pile up. You can quarantine a tenant's formulas with the kill-switch flag, which takes effect within a minute. Escalation steps and the quarantine procedure are laid out on the internal page below.

wiki page, bagaf-fawip: https://harbor.tolvaqsys.local/pages/repo/pages/secrets/eac969ffc71f356b

Subject: Warranty costs on the Kestral 9 — heads up

Team,

Quick one for you to pass to branch managers: warranty claims on the Kestral 9 range ran 38% over budget last quarter, mostly hinge failures. We're covering repairs centrally for now, so don't absorb costs locally. Vornex Manufacturing is reworking the component and we expect relief by spring. Keep claim logs tidy — we'll need them. The confidential note below explains where this fits in our wider plans.

management briefing: Casvanek Logistics plans to lower the Druox list price by 49.1 percent in April. The board signed off on a budget of $16.5 million for Project Rusath. The renewal with Kasvanix Partners closes at $67.9 million a year, 33.9 percent above the last contract. Project Casath slips by one quarter because of the staffing delay.

Action item: move the Ledgerline billing worker to blue-green deploys. Current in-place restarts drop in-flight invoice jobs, which caused the duplicate-charge incident. Requirements: drain queue before cutover, health-check the green pool for five minutes, keep blue warm for instant rollback. Security note: both pools must share the same secrets rotation window. Owner: Priya. Due end of month. Rollout plan and checklist are on the internal page.

runbook for badug-kadup: https://confluence.zemvarlabs.internal/projects/browse/display/projects/bd1b

## Alert: Quickfind index latency high

This alert fires when the Quickfind autocomplete index takes longer than 400ms at p95 for ten consecutive minutes. Usual cause is a nightly reindex overlapping peak traffic; check the indexer job status first. If the index shards show uneven document counts, trigger a rebalance — instructions are in the runbook. Do not restart the query nodes yourself. If the rebalance doesn't clear it within an hour, contact the search team.

escalation mailbox, bafog-fafog: ulador@paliqlabs.internal